Abstract
The utility model relates to construction equipment technology fields, and disclose a kind of template of architectural engineering, including steel form, the vertical reinforcing rib and cross reinforcing that multiple pairs of ontologies are reinforced are welded on the inside of the steel form, the vertical reinforcing rib and the interlaced multiple rectangular grids of formation of cross reinforcing, the middle active force being locally subject to for dispersing steel form, the two sides of the steel form open up hole, and the quantity of described hole is four.The template of the architectural engineering, it is limited by position of the fixed ring to adjusting rod, so that the motion track of adjusting rod receives limitation, and the threaded rod in fixed plate is contacted with the hole on another steel form, so that fixed plate and nut oppress two steel forms, two steel forms is allowed to be fixed on threaded rod, to make two steel forms be fixed to each other, in this way, having the function that avoid steel form during assembly from being easy to fall convenient for assembly.

Background technique
Steel form is also known as alternative plank sheathing, reduces significantly and usually seals mould with tradition such as timber, glued board or steel plates
Exclusion of the plate to pore water pressure and bubble in concrete pressure after steel template structure concrete castable, forms one
A ideal rough interfaces do not need scabble operation and can enter next process and construct, both can installation reinforcing bar it
Preceding placement can also be placed after installing reinforcing bar, be placed if it is before installing reinforcing bar, and placement is easy for installation simple, can
Visual control is carried out with the casting process to concrete, to reduce the risk for phenomena such as hole and honeycomb structure occur.
Steel form can form the required any shape of emergency sealing end, therefore the punching block in construction as a kind of standby
Plate gradually replaces wooden template, however existing steel form needs first to carry out assembly during making, then by device into
Row is fixed, but steel form is easy to fall during assembly, and we have proposed a kind of templates of architectural engineering thus.

A kind of template of architectural engineering referring to FIG. 1-2, including steel form 1, the inside of steel form 1 are welded with multiple
To vertical reinforcing rib 2 and cross reinforcing 3 that ontology is reinforced, vertical reinforcing rib 2 and the interlaced formation of cross reinforcing 3
Multiple rectangular grids, the middle active force being locally subject to for dispersing steel form 1, the two sides of steel form 1 open up hole 4, hole 4
Quantity be four, four holes 4 are evenly distributed on the two sides of steel form 1, and it is useful that steel form 1 is located at fixed installation in rectangular grid
In the fixed ring 5 of position-limiting action, the quantity of fixed ring 5 is two, and two fixed rings 5 are distributed in two squares of 1 inside of steel form
In shape lattice, the inside movable sleeve of fixed ring 5 is connected to adjusting rod 6, and the other end of adjusting rod 6 is fixedly installed with fixed plate 7, fixed plate
The both ends of 7 sides are fixedly installed with threaded rod 8, and for connecting steel form 1, adjusting rod 6 is adjusted when moving in fixed ring 5
Pole 6 is contacted with fixed ring 5 always, and adjusting rod 6 passes through hole 4 for adjusting 8 position of threaded rod, one end of two threaded rods 8
It extends to the outside of steel form 1 and screw thread is socketed with nut 9, for fixing the position of two steel forms 1, the inside of steel form 1
By 4 pivot bush unit of hole of threaded rod 8 and another 1 side of steel form, and the side of nut 9 and another steel form 1
Inside face contact, when retraction 1 inside of steel form of threaded rod 8, and threaded rod 8 is contacted with the hole 4 in 1 outside of steel form always,
The template of the architectural engineering is limited by position of the fixed ring 5 to adjusting rod 6, so that the motion track of adjusting rod 6 is received
To limitation, and the threaded rod 8 in fixed plate 7 is contacted with the hole 4 on another steel form 1, so that fixed plate 7 and nut 9 are right
Two steel forms 1 are oppressed, and two steel forms 1 is allowed to be fixed on threaded rod 8, to make two steel forms 1 be fixed to each other, such as
This, has the function that be avoided steel form 1 during assembly from being easy to fall convenient for assembly.
Working principle: two steel forms 1 being contacted, adjusting rod 6 is then moved, so that threaded rod 8 protrudes into another punching block
In hole 4 on plate 1, nut 9 is installed, and tighten later, repeatedly, completes the assembled process of multiple steel forms 1.
